UK Implementation Department of Environment Food Scottish Executive & Rural Affairs Northern Ireland Welsh Assembly Government SEPA Environment Agency Environment & Heritage Service Scottish Natural Heritage Northern Ireland Natural England, CCW UK Technical Advisory Group & UK Economics Steering Group Within the UK DEFRA set up an Implementation Steering Group. This group has representation from relevant government departments and was responsible for transcribing the Directive into UK law. The DEFRA implementation steering group was also responsible for developing the consultation documents associated with transposing the Directive. A UK technical advisory group was established to supply the ISG and devolved governments with a common UK understanding and technical interpretation of the Directive and to produce technical position papers with regard to implementation of the Directive in the UK. This group is supported by a network of new and existing technical groups. Co-ordination of technical and economic advice for UK administrations
